Is 13200 a prime number?

Is 13200 a prime or composite number?

Answer: Number 13200 is not a Prime
13200 - is not a Prime Number because it has 60 factors: 1, 2, 3, 4, 5, 6, 8, 10, 11, 12, 15, 16, 20, 22, 24, 25, 30, 33, 40, 44, 48, 50, 55, 60, 66, 75, 80, 88, 100, 110, 120, 132, 150, 165, 176, 200, 220, 240, 264, 275, 300, 330, 400, 440, 528, 550, 600, 660, 825, 880, 1100, 1200, 1320, 1650, 2200, 2640, 3300, 4400, 6600, 13200
Number should have exactly two factors to be classified as a Prime number
For 13200 to be a prime number it must have only two divisors - 1 and itself (13200)
